Black Crested Mangabey vs Pink fairy armadillo
Lophocebus aterrimus compared with Chlamyphorus truncatus
Key Differences
- Black Crested Mangabey is Vulnerable while Pink fairy armadillo is Data Deficient.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Black Crested Mangabey | Pink fairy armadillo |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class same | Mammalia (Mammals)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Primates (Primates) | Cingulata (Cingulata) |
| Family | Cercopithecidae (Old World Monkeys) | Dasypodidae |
| Genus | Lophocebus | Chlamyphorus |
| Species | Lophocebus aterrimus | Chlamyphorus truncatus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Black Crested Mangabey and Pink fairy armadillo share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(Mammals)
